Apartment pressure cleaning services involve using high-pressure water streams to thoroughly clean building exteriors, including walls, walkways, balconies, and parking areas. This process effectively removes dirt, grime, mold, algae, and other buildup that can accumulate over time due to weather exposure and daily use. The cleaning is typically performed with specialized equipment that delivers a powerful yet controlled spray, making it easier to restore the appearance of the property’s surfaces without causing damage. Many property owners opt for pressure cleaning to maintain a clean, attractive environment and to prepare surfaces for painting or other renovations.
This service helps address common problems such as unsightly stains, slippery moss or algae growth, and the buildup of dirt that can make a property look neglected. Over time, these issues can lead to surface deterioration or safety hazards, especially on walkways and stairs. Regular pressure cleaning can also prevent the development of mold and mildew, which can impact indoor air quality if left unchecked. The overview below groups typical Apartment Pressure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cherry Hill,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Pressure Cleaning Jobs - Typical costs for routine apartment pressure cleaning in Cherry Hill range from $250 to $600. Many projects fall within this range, covering common exterior surfaces like walkways and patios. Less extensive jobs may cost less, especially if only a few areas are involved.
Medium-Sized Projects - Larger apartment complexes or multiple building facades us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are more common for properties requiring comprehensive cleaning of exterior walls, driveways, or parking lots. The cost varies based on size and surface types.
Extensive or Complex Jobs - For large-scale or detailed pressure cleaning projects, prices can range from $1,500 to $3,000. These are less frequent but may include multi-building complexes or properties with extensive surface areas needing specialized treatments.
Full Replacement or Heavy-Duty Cleaning - In rare cases involving significant surface repairs or complete exterior overhauls, costs can exceed $3,000 and re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are typically customized based on the scope and complexity of the work involved.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Is apartment pressure cleaning suitable for all types of building exteriors? Most exterior surfaces like brick, stucco, vinyl, and concrete are compatible with pressure cleaning, but it's best to consult with local service providers for specific material considerations.
How often should apartment exteriors be pressure cleaned? Frequency depends on location and exposure to elements, but many property managers opt for annual or bi-annual cleaning to keep exteriors well-maintained.
